How to fill out new patient intake form

Illustration

How to fill out new patient intake form

01
Begin by writing down the patient's personal information, including name, date of birth, and contact details.
02
Fill out the insurance information section, if applicable, including policy number and provider details.
03
Complete the medical history section by providing information on past illnesses, surgeries, and medications currently being taken.
04
Indicate any allergies the patient may have, including food, medication, and environmental allergies.
05
Provide family medical history, highlighting any hereditary conditions or diseases present in the family.
06
Review the patient’s lifestyle habits, including smoking, alcohol consumption, exercise, and diet.
07
If applicable, fill out the section regarding the reason for the visit or specific concerns the patient wishes to discuss.
08
Sign and date the form to confirm that the information provided is accurate to the best of your knowledge.

Who needs new patient intake form?

01
New patients seeking initial healthcare services at a medical practice or facility.
02
Patients who are switching healthcare providers or practices.
03
Individuals who are required to update their medical records or provide new information due to changes in health or insurance.

A new patient intake form is a document that collects essential information about a patient during their first visit to a healthcare provider, helping to facilitate their care.
All new patients seeking medical care or services at a healthcare facility are required to fill out a new patient intake form.
To fill out a new patient intake form, patients should provide accurate personal information, medical history, current medications, allergies, and insurance details as prompted on the form.
The purpose of the new patient intake form is to gather necessary information to ensure the healthcare providers can offer appropriate and personalized medical treatment.
The information typically required includes the patient's name, contact details, date of birth, medical history, current medications, allergies, and insurance information.
